发明名称 Driver for switching element and control system for rotary machine using the same
摘要 In a driver, a clamping module executes a clamping task that clamps an on-off control terminal voltage to be equal to or lower than a clamp voltage for a predetermined time during charging of the on-off control terminal of the switching element. The clamp voltage is lower than an upper limit of the voltage at the on-off control terminal of the switching element. A measuring module measures a parameter value correlated with a sense current correlated with a current flowing between input and output terminals of the switching element. A limiting module discharges the on-off control terminal to limit flow of the current between the input and output terminals if the value of the parameter exceeds a threshold. A setting module variably sets a length of the predetermined time as a function of the parameter value during charging of the switching element's on-off control terminal.

A driver for driving a switching element having an input terminal, an output terminal, an on-off control terminal, and a sense terminal from which a sense current correlated with a current flowing between the input and output terminals is output, the driver comprising: a charging module configured to charge the on-off control terminal of the switching element for turning on the switching element; a clamping module configured to execute a clamping task that clamps a voltage at the on-off control terminal to be equal to or lower than a predetermined voltage as a clamp voltage for predetermined time during the charge of the on-off control terminal of the switching element, the clamp voltage being lower than an upper limit of the voltage at the on-off control terminal of the switching element; a measuring module configured to measure a value of a parameter correlated with the sense current; a limiting module configured to discharge the on-off control terminal to limit flow of the current between the input and output terminals if the value of the parameter measured by the measuring module exceeds a threshold value; and a setting module configured to variably set a length of the predetermined time as a function of the value of the parameter measured by the measuring module during the charge of the on-off control terminal of the switching element.
